Broadscale habitat (EUNIS level3) for the Mid St Geroge's Channel recommended Marine Conservation Zone (rMCZ)
Feature class depicting broadscale habitat features at the Mid St GeorgeÔÇÖs Channel rMCZ. The map is a result of an integrated analysis of newly acquired and previously available acoustic data together with ground-truthing data collected by a dedicated survey of the sitein 2013. Habitat classes observed at each ground-truthing station were used to inform a semi-automated process of map production using object-based image analysis (OBIA). The map shows the seabed at the site to be characterised largely by ÔÇÿA5.1 Subtidal coarse sedimentÔÇÖ and ÔÇÿA5.4 Subtidal mixed sedimentsÔÇÖ, which are mapped together as a complex due to difficulty in separating the two from the underlying acoustic data. Smaller patches of ÔÇÿA5.2 Subtidal sandÔÇÖ and ÔÇÿA4.2 Moderate energy circalittoral rockÔÇÖ are also found within the site.
A new habitat map for the Mid St Georges Channel Marine recommended Marine Conservation Zone (rMCZ) was produced by analysing and interpreting newly acquired and previously available acoustic data together with ground-truthing data collected by a dedicated survey of the site.
Full coverage multibeam echosounder (MBES) data covering 70% of the Mid St GeorgeÔÇÖs Channel rMCZ was collected in 2012 by Osiris Projects. An additional block of full coverage MBES data was collected by RV Cefas Endeavour on CEND05/13, adding a further 5% area coverage of the site. The remaining 25% of the rMCZ has partial coverage (31%) MBES data collected under the Mid Irish Sea Project. Ground-truth sampling for the site was planned using a standard MCZ ground-truthing sampling grid, applied to different habitat types identified from the processed bathymetry and backscatter layers. Station positions were then modified to target features of interest, in particular suspected reef features. The survey was carried out between 1-6th May 2013 on the RV CEFAS Endeavour cruise CEND0513. Ground truth samples were collected from 130 stations. Benthic grab samples were recovered at 115 stations, video transects at 71stations and short (2 minute) deployments of the drop camera were carried out at a further 49 grab stations. The new habitat map was produced via a combination of object-based image analysis (OBIA) of the acoustic data, implemented in the software package eCognition┬« v8.7.2, and expert judgement aided by statistical analysis, linking the ground truth observations to the acoustic and topographic properties.
